Southland Idealease

3699 W Park Ave, Gray, LA 70359
Southland Idealease Southland Idealease is one of the popular Car Rental located in 3699 W Park Ave ,Gray listed under Car Rental in Gray ,

Contact Details & Working Hours

Map of Southland Idealease